1999 GMC Sierra vs. 1999 Holden Berlina
To start off, both 1999 GMC Sierra and 1999 Holden Berlina were released in the same year (1999).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 4,293 cc (6 cylinders), 1999 GMC Sierra is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Holden Berlina (229 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 32 more horse power than 1999 GMC Sierra. (197 HP @ 4600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1999 Holden Berlina should accelerate faster than 1999 GMC Sierra.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 GMC Sierra weights approximately 135 kg more than 1999 Holden Berlina.
Because 1999 GMC Sierra is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1999 Holden Berlina.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 GMC Sierra will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Holden Berlina (375 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 GMC Sierra. (352 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 1999 Holden Berlina will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 GMC Sierra.
Compare all specifications:
1999 GMC Sierra | 1999 Holden Berlina | |
Make | GMC | Holden |
Model | Sierra | Berlina |
Year Released | 1999 | 1999 |
Body Type | Pickup | Station Wagon |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4293 cc | 3791 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 197 HP | 229 HP |
Engine RPM | 4600 RPM | 5200 RPM |
Torque | 352 Nm | 375 Nm |
Torque RPM | 2800 RPM | 3000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Vehicle Weight | 1775 kg | 1640 kg |
Vehicle Length | 5170 mm | 5090 mm |
Vehicle Width | 2000 mm | 1850 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1810 mm | 1550 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3030 mm | 2950 mm |
